How do I get inspiration?

There are many places where you can get inspiration. This would include online such as pinterest or instagram. You should always look at previous artists work and see how you can combine their techniques to produce something new. Inspiration is everywhere, from the natural world to everyday routines. Talking to other people about a range of topics is also very helpful.
Basing your ideas around interesting subject matter is very important. For example, if you were interested in gender, do not just use women. Look more into specific aspects of gender such as the male gaze. Possibly even how men are affected by gender stereotypes.
